Why Measures Matter in Power BI
Measures are calculations used in data analysis that can be created using the DAX language (Data Analysis Expressions). They are essential because they allow you to perform computations on your data, such as sums, averages, and ratios, that are then used in your Power BI reports and dashboards.
Step-by-Step Guide to Creating a Measure in Power BI
Follow these simple steps to master creating a measure in Power BI:
- Open Power BI Desktop: Start by launching your Power BI Desktop application.
- Select Your Table: Choose the relevant table where you want to create the measure.
- Go to ‘Model’ Tab: Navigate to the Model tab and right-click on the table you?ve chosen.
- Create the Measure: Click on “New Measure”. A formula bar will appear where you can write your DAX expression.
-
Write Your DAX Formula: Here, type in your desired calculation, such as
=SUM(Sales[Amount])or=AVERAGE(Sales[Profit]). - Commit the Formula: Press Enter, and your measure is now a part of your data model!
These calculated fields allow you to customize your data representation, making it more insightful and tailored to your specific business needs.
